WebNov 24, 2016 · To get a number ending with 0 in decimal system, we need a 5 and an even number to be multiplied. The first 0 appears in 5! because we have 5 times an even number (I.e. 2 or 4). It is when we get to 10! That we encounter with the next 5. And in 10! we also have an even number to times it with 5 and make it a number ending with 0. WebAug 15, 2007 · This first and most common kind of silent final e “makes the letter say its name.”. 2. English words don’t end in v or u. The e at the end of have and blue do not affect pronunciation. The e is there because the words would otherwise end in v or u. Impromptu is one of the few exceptions to this rule. 3.

WebOct 6, 2024 · Specifically, the denominator (bottom number) is spoken as an ordinal. ¼ -> one-fourth. However, the most common fraction, ½, is called simply half or one half—saying one-second is incorrect. WebJan 29, 2024 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 12 From BigInt on MDN: A BigInt is created by appending n to the end of an integer literal — 10n — or by calling the function BigInt (). In essence, BigInt allows for storing large integers, as otherwise a large numeric literal would be converted into a floating point and lose precision of the least significant digits. WebJan 28, 2016 · 1 It's another way to express scientific notation; the numbers before E represent the front factor, and the numbers after represent the power (base 10). So, if you see a E b = a ⋅ 10 b. Share Cite Follow answered Jan 28, 2016 at 9:53 user238841 Add a comment 0 It's 10 x. For example 3 e − 4 = 3 ⋅ 10 − 4. Share Cite Follow

WebMay 17, 2016 · These account for 180 zeros. There and 36 multiples of 25. Excluding the zeros we already counted these will account for 36 new zeros. There are 7 multiples of 125 so there are 7 more 0. And 625 will account for 1 more. So 900! ends with 180 + 36 + 7 + 1 = 224 zerros. fleablood. May 17, 2016 at 17:04.
